#4fa453 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4fa453 is composed of 31% red, 64.3%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 49.4% yellow and 35.7% black. It has a hue angle of 122.8 degrees, a saturation of 35% and a lightness of 47.6%. #4fa453 color hex could be obtained by blending #9effa6 with #004900.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

● #4fa453 color description : Dark moderate lime green.
#4fa453 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4fa453 has RGB values of R:79, G:164, B:83 and CMYK values of C:0.52, M:0, Y:0.49, K:0.36. Its decimal value is 5219411.

Shades and Tints of #4fa453
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020503 is the darkest color, while #f7fb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4fa453
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#747f75 is the less saturated color, while #04ef0f is the most saturated one.
